It's As Easy As "READY, FIRE, AIM!"

In a day when there seem to be countless but often daunting approaches to evangelism, SE is as simple as doing the simple actions of Jesus. In his 3-year ministry, Jesus modeled about three dozen actions – all of which brought God’s Kingdom into the world. As his followers, we are called to imitate this model--to feed the hungry, give water to the thirsty, and bring healing to all – whether broken in spirit, body, or soul.

We have that same calling upon our lives. We meet not-yet believers exactly where they are and let them experience the gospel without hostility or offense. What’s more - using this servant model, anyone can thrive as an evangelist, whether outgoing or shy, a new believer or a great theologian. EVERYONE can do this and have fun while they do!

About Steve Sjogren (organizer and host of this conference)

Steve Sjogren is a well-known Christian author and leader who pioneered the concept of servant evangelism. He founded the Vineyard Community Church in Cincinnati, Ohio, which grew significantly under his leadership, emphasizing practical acts of kindness as a means of outreach. This approach has been influential in many churches and communities worldwide.

Sjogren has written several books, including Conspiracy of Kindness and Changing the World through Kindness, which have collectively sold over 500,000 copies. His works focus on the idea that simple, loving actions can have a profound impact on individuals and communities, aligning with the Biblical principle that “the kindness of God leads to repentance” (Romans 2:4).

In addition to his writing, Steve has been actively involved in church planting, both in the United States and internationally, including places like Oslo, Norway. His innovative methods and teachings have been featured in numerous publications, such as The Wall Street Journal and Christianity Today, and he continues to mentor and coach church leaders and planters through his various initiatives and websites like KindnessExplosion.com.
